Garwal - Gandhwani, Dhar
Garwal is a village situated in the Gandhwani tehsil of Dhar district, Madhya Pradesh. Garwal village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Garwal is 475292. The village covers a total geographical area of 164.35 hectares and falls under the 454446 pincode. Manawar is the nearest town.
Garwal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Garwal
As per Census 2011, Garwal village has a total population of 731 people, consisting of 354 males and 377 females. The village has 144 households and a sex ratio of 1,064 females per 1,000 males. There are 114 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 347 literate and 384 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 729 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Garwal
Garwal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Mhow, while the nearest airport is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 74.4 km.
